what will happen in counselling?? if we get selected in 1st round then we are eligible for the collage or should we get selected till last round???

Hello,
If you are alloted a seat in 1st round of counselling and if you are satisfied with it then you can accept the seat within the notice period.And you must report at the respective college for document verification and payment of fee and reserve your seat.If you are not satisfied you can participate in subsequent counselling.
Incase if you are not alloted any seat in 1st counselling you can also participate in subsequent counselling.
